Engineer I Level responsibilities of this position include the following: Analyze and design equipment, building and steel structures and foundations. Develop moderately complex studies of limited scope and prepare data for cost estimations and analyses. Develop structural plans, details, and calculations. Develop site, grading and fence plans in AutoCAD. Develop structural drawing mark ups for drafters and designers.
Conduct site inspections to ensure adherence to engineering standards. Review construction submittals to ensure adherence to company engineering standards. Prepare and review structural calculations, designs, details, drawings and construction specifications for substation structures and foundations.
In addition, the Engineer II level responsibilities include: Design, develop, modify, and evaluate structures, foundations, process, or facilities to support Company objectives. Develop civil/structural engineering studies, plans, specifications, calculations, evaluations, design documents, and performance assessments. Determine methods and techniques for obtaining results. Guide and direct associate level engineers, technicians and drafters. Recommend alternative solutions to management in area of specialty on engineering solutions to meet business needs. Deliver on commitments and manage outside engineering services to accomplish the assigned work. Analyze and design engineering methods.
In addition, the Sr. Level responsibilities include: Perform engineering responsibilities without assistance and little or no supervision. Perform role as expert civil/structural consultant for field operations and customers. Act as a lead expert in the work group; train and mentor associate and career level engineers, and technicians. Design, develop, modify, and evaluate systems, process, or facilities to support company objectives, utilizing engineering methods. Develop highly complex engineering studies, plans, specifications, calculations, evaluations, design documents, and performance assessments. Maintain project timelines and budgets.
REQUIREMENTS:
Engineer I Level requirements for this position include the following:
•Bachelor's Degree in Civil Engineering from an accredited college/university •Basic knowledge and application of principles in area of engineering specialty •Knowledge of applicable federal, state, and local laws and regulations •Ability to interact favorably with project and work teams •Communication and interpersonal skills involving the ability to work cross-functionally to understand requirements, present alternatives, and recommendations •Proficient with the use of personal computers and automated tools •Hold a valid driver’s license, ability to travel and perform field work as needed.
In addition, the Engineer II role includes: •A minimum of two years of directly related experience in engineering related field. •Knowledge of applicable federal, state, local laws regulations and the ASCE, NEC and IEEE codes. •Ability to perform effectively in high-pressure situations while maintaining focus and calmness •Ability to provide timely assessments with limited information and/or assumptions.
In addition, the Sr. Level Engineer includes: •A minimum of five years of directly related experience in engineering related field. •Hold a valid Professional Engineering license in civil engineering. •Demonstrated knowledge and application of principles in area of engineering specialty. •Project management and leadership skills including the ability to work as a team member, to maintain project timelines, budgets, and deliver on commitments.

About PacifiCorp
PacifiCorp is the largest grid operator in the western United States, serving the growing energy needs of 1.9 million customers while protecting the environment. Our two business units are leaders in providing safe, reliable, low-cost and sustainable power.
Pacific Power serves customers in Oregon, Washington and California. Rocky Mountain Power serves customers in Utah, Wyoming and Idaho.
